Posted by: Dénes February 03, 2009 06:35 am
The message is in Hungarian.
The soldier's name was Szathmáry (family name) Dezső (first name).
The unit was the 3rd Company, 1st Platoon.
The date is 8 Nov. 1928.
Location: Nagyvárad (then Oradea-Mare, today Oradea).
